Batman comic book artist dies
Jerry Robinson, creator of comic book characters including Batman’s trusty sidekick Robin and arch enemy The Joker has died aged 89. DC Entertainment Co-Publisher Jim Lee said “Jerry Robinson illustrated some of the defining images of pop culture’s greatest icons.
